Trafford Parent Partnership Service

What is the Parent Partnership Service?

Trafford Parent Partnership Service is for parents/carers:

  • whose children have been assessed as having special educational needs
  • who believe their children may have special educational needs
  • whose children have a disability recognised under the Disability Discrimination Act.

How can we help?

The Trafford Parent Partnership Service can:

  • explain the assessment process and the Code of Practice for special educational needs
  • help you to give your views about your child's special educational needs
  • support you at meetings;
  • help you with any letters or forms
  • help you understand your child's statement of special educational needs
  • help you pass on your concerns to your child's school or to a member of the Local Authority
  • put you in touch with staff from other agencies and voluntary organisations who may be able to give advice and information
  • support you at Disagreement Resolution Service meetings (meetings where parents can discuss their child's needs with the school or LA)
  • explain how you can appeal about decisions the LA have made, to the special educational needs tribunal (SEND)
  • give you information about the Disability Discrimination Act (DDA)
  • give you advice when your child starts at school or nursery
  • give you information about your child moving from infant school (Key Stage 1) to junior school (Key Stage 2) or to a secondary school (Key Stage 3).
